A Melting Pot of Cultures: Diversity in the USA
The United States, often referred to as a "melting pot," is home to a staggering array of cultures, ethnicities, and backgrounds. People living in the United States hail from every corner of the globe, making it one of the most diverse countries on Earth.
Did you know? As of 2021, the U.S. Census Bureau estimates that there are over 330 million people living in the United States. This diverse population includes people of various races, ethnicities, religions, sexual orientations, and abilities.
A Brief History of Immigration
The story of people living in the United States is a tale of immigration, stretching back to the 1600s when the first English settlers arrived. Over the centuries, waves of immigrants from Europe, Asia, Latin America, and beyond have shaped the country's cultural landscape.
Key immigration events include:
- The Great Migration (1910-1930), when millions of African Americans moved from the rural South to the North in search of better opportunities. - The Bracero Program (1942-1964), which brought millions of Mexican farmworkers to the U.S. - The Refugee Act of 1980, which established procedures for admitting refugees into the U.S.

Urban Living: Cities That Never Sleep
From the bustling streets of New York City to the sunny beaches of Los Angeles, cities in the United States offer a dynamic blend of cultures, cuisines, and experiences. City dwellers enjoy access to world-class museums, vibrant nightlife, and diverse communities.
Fun fact: New York City is the most populous city in the U.S., with over 8.3 million residents. It's also one of the most diverse, with over 800 languages spoken in its five boroughs.
Suburban Life: The American Dream in Action
Suburban living is a staple of life in the United States, with many families seeking the idyllic blend of privacy, community, and affordability that the suburbs offer. These residential areas often feature well-regarded school systems, parks, and a strong sense of neighborly camaraderie.
Did you know? The U.S. suburbs are home to approximately 140 million people, or about 48% of the total U.S. population.
